L3Harris is seeking a Manufacturing Technician C to work at our Orange, VA location. Our site near Culpeper, VA, in beautiful, rural Orange County (1.5 hours from Washington, DC) is growing!  This site is our center of excellence for Solid Rocket Motor Propulsion and Energetics development as well as high-complexity production programs

The successful individual will perform functions such as fabrication of components, clean and assemble equipment, cleans tools, parts, and work area, operate machinery. Pressure tests, bonds, assembles, precision part clean, mix adhesives, torques fasteners, and all other duties and tasks required to assemble and prepare for shipment of products. Maintains records for manufactured products. Works safely while producing a high quality product and maintaining a clean and orderly work area.

Under general supervision, the Manufacturing Technician performs a wide range of duties within the manufacturing operations area. Applies specialized manufacturing knowledge to basic problems to come up with logical answers.

Qualifications:

  • Requires a High School Diploma or equivalent and a minimum of 6 years of prior relevant experience or 2 years post-Secondary/Associates Degree with a minimum of 2 years of prior related experience.

Preferred Additional Skills:

  • Preferred Precision Assembly Knowledge/Skill: Use of torque tooling, mix and apply adhesives, leak check testing, pressurized systems, electrical grounding and bonding checks, electrical connectors and electromechanical component assembly and test, general computer (windows), Standard Measurement Instruments (SMI), and precision component cleaning.
  • Knowledge/Skills: Use of precision scales, operation of industrial processing equipment, cleaning solvents, mixing operations, inventory control, record keeping, and assembly of process tooling.

L3 Harris is one of the largest defense and aerospace companies in the United States, delivering advanced technologies that support missions across air, land, sea, space, and cyber domains. The company develops communications systems, space payloads, intelligence platforms, electronic warfare capabilities, missile defense technologies, and mission-critical sensors used by the U.S. military, intelligence community, and allied nations around the world.
